E–Pavletich (1), Vidal (1), Oyler (1). DP–Chicago 1, Seattle 2. PB–Josephson (2). 2B–Chicago Pavletich (1,off Brabender); Hopkins (1,off Morris), Seattle Haney (1,off Peters); Rollins (3,off Wood). 3B–Chicago Melton (1,off Brabender); Bradford (1,off Bouton). HR–Chicago Ward (1,1st inning off Pattin 1 on, 1 out); Melton (1,1st inning off Pattin 0 on, 1 out); Held (1,2nd inning off Brabender 0 on, 0 out); Hopkins (1,3rd inning off Brabender 1 on, 1 out); Pavletich (1,4th inning off Bouton 0 on, 2 out), Seattle Davis (1,9th inning off Wood 0 on, 0 out); Vidal (1,9th inning off Wood 0 on, 2 out). SH–Wood (1,off Morris). SF–Hansen (1,off Brabender); Melton (2,off Bouton). SB–Aparicio (3,2nd base off Bouton/Haney); Hansen (1,2nd base off Morris/Haney); Harper (3,3rd base off Peters/Pavletich); Comer (1,2nd base off Peters/Pavletich). U-HP–Red Flaherty, 1B–Bob Stewart, 2B–Don Denkinger, 3B–Marty Springstead. T–2:58. A–10,031. |
